How Unlicensed Casinos in Germany Work

Online casinos in Germany keep increasing in popularity, and there are plenty of options to choose from at the moment. As the online gaming market in Germany has been regulated since 2016, there are several rules and laws that need to be followed to obtain a German License.

From the 1st of January 2023, the GGL (Glücksspielbehörde der Länder) has been responsible for approving and revoking these permits, and over 50 operators had already been granted this license during the first month.

There are also some restrictions applying for German casino players, such as monthly deposit limits, stake limits on slots, and limited availability on live casino games, jackpot slots and sports betting. However, there is a way to bypass these restrictions, and some players are doing so by choosing casinos operating outside the German jurisdiction. Even though the German authorities are doing their best to avoid these activities, it is still legal for Germans to play at such online casinos.

These operators usually use online casino licenses from other jurisdictions, such as the United Kingdom Gambling Commission (UKGC),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), or licenses from Curacao. The strictness of the rules will depend a bit on what license the casino in question is using, where the UKGC is the strictest, followed by the MGA license and Curacao. Even though playing with fewer restrictions might be more fun, it might also come with a slightly higher risk.

If a casino is using one of the abovementioned licenses, they should be considered reliable. However, if you get into a dispute with a casino without a German license, you cannot expect any help from the authorities. Therefore, it is important to compare the pros and cons before making a decision about what the best choice would be for you.

casinos without german licensPros and Cons – Casinos without German License

Comparing pros and cons is essential before making the decision to play at online casinos without a German license or staying in the German market.

Offshore casinos give you access to more slot games, do not require deposit limits, and you do not have to wait long between your game rounds. However, if you get into trouble, it can be harder to get justice. We have listed some pros and cons of unlicensed casinos for you below.

Pros

  • Bigger welcome packages
  • More reload bonuses and loyalty programmes
  • Available for all German players
  • No delay between spins when playing a virtual slot machine game
  • Slots are not limited to €1 per spin
  • You decide if you want deposit limits or not
  • No tax on winnings from sports betting
  • Better variety of games and software providers

Cons

  • No possibility to complain to German Gambling Authorities in case of a dispute
  • The national self-exclusion program does not work
  • Such casinos do not follow German law
  • Some casinos do not offer customer support in German
